Introduction to Live Roulette
Live roulette is a real-time casino game where a physical wheel is spun by a live dealer. Players place bets on where a ball will land on the numbered wheel.
Main betting options include:
- Single numbers
- Colors (red or black)
- Odd or even
- Number ranges (1–18 or 19–36)
Even though many betting systems exist, the outcome of each spin remains completely random.
How Roulette Odds Actually Work
Roulette is based on fixed probability, not skill.
European Roulette:
- 37 pockets (0–36)
- House edge: ~2.7%
American Roulette:
- 38 pockets (0, 00, 1–36)
- House edge: ~5.26%
The presence of the zero (and double zero in American roulette) gives the casino its advantage.
Understanding Betting Systems in Roulette
Betting systems are structured ways players manage bets, but they do not change probability.
They mainly affect:
- Risk management
- Bet sizing
- Emotional control
Let’s explore the most common systems.
1. Martingale System (High Risk)
This is one of the most famous strategies.
How it works:
- Double your bet after every loss
- Return to base bet after a win
Example progression:
- $1 → $2 → $4 → $8 → $16
Next Bet=Base Bet×2n
Risk:
- Requires large bankroll
- Table limits can stop progression
- Risk of rapid losses
2. Fibonacci System (Moderate Risk)
This system uses a number sequence:
1, 1, 2, 3, 5, 8, 13…
How it works:
- Increase bet following Fibonacci sequence after losses
- Move back two steps after a win
Advantage:
- Slower bankroll depletion than Martingale
Disadvantage:
- Still does not change house edge
3. D’Alembert System (Low Risk)
A more conservative system.
Rules:
- Increase bet by 1 unit after loss
- Decrease bet by 1 unit after win
Example:
- $10 → $11 → $12 (losses)
- $12 → $11 → $10 (wins)
This system focuses on balance rather than aggression.
4. Flat Betting Strategy (Most Stable)
Flat betting means:
- Same bet every round
- No progression after wins or losses
Example:
- Always bet $5 per spin
Advantage:
- Lowest risk
- Best bankroll control
Disadvantage:
- Slower profit growth
Why Betting Systems Don’t Beat Roulette
All roulette systems share one limitation:
- They do not change probability
- Each spin is independent
- House edge remains constant
Even structured systems cannot overcome randomness.
The Role of Bankroll Management
Proper bankroll control is more important than any betting system.
A simple safe guideline:
Safe Bet Size=50 to 100Total Bankroll
Example:
- Bankroll = $500
- Safe bet = $5–$10 per spin
This helps reduce risk of fast depletion.
Table Limits and Their Impact
Roulette tables have minimum and maximum betting limits.
Why this matters:
- Progressive systems can fail due to max limits
- Large bets may not be allowed
- Strategy progression may break
This is a major limitation of aggressive systems.
Emotional Control in Roulette Strategy
Most losses in roulette come from behavior, not mathematics.
Common mistakes:
- Chasing losses
- Increasing bets emotionally
- Switching systems too often
- Playing too long without breaks
Discipline is more important than strategy complexity.
Difference Between Strategy and Probability
It’s important to separate:
- Strategy = how you manage bets
- Probability = fixed odds of the game
No betting system changes:
- Wheel randomness
- House edge
- Long-term expected results
